Cin7 vs Odoo FAQ

Which one is cheaper?
Odoo is the cheaper option, starting at $31/mo vs $349/mo for Cin7.
Can I use either one for free?
Odoo has a free plan. Cin7 doesn't — though they do offer a free trial.
How do they charge?
Different approach here. Cin7 uses flat-rate pricing, while Odoo goes with per-seat. That changes the math depending on your team size and usage.
Which one is a better deal?
Depends on what you need. Cin7: At $349 to $999/mo before you even get to Omni, Cin7 sits firmly in the mid-to-premium range for inventory management platforms — well above lightweight tools like inFlow but positioned to compete with heavier ERP-adjacent players. They're chasing growing SMBs and mid-market brands who've outgrown spreadsheets or entry-level tools but aren't ready for full ERP price tags. Odoo: Odoo undercuts the Salesforce/NetSuite/HubSpot crowd hard, positioning as the budget-friendly all-in-one suite rather than a best-of-breed point solution. They're chasing SMBs and scrappier mid-market teams who want ERP-lite functionality without ERP-level invoices.
